A make-ahead twist on two classics, pizza and shepherd's pie, this simple skillet recipe is hearty but not heavy.

Ingredients
Mashed Potatoes:
2poundsyukon gold potatoes
1/2 - 3/4cupchicken broth
3tbspghee(or butter, if you don't need this to be dairy-free/paleo)
uncured pepperoni
salt and pepper to taste
Meat Layer:
1 1/2 - 2poundsground turkey
1/2cupred onion, diced
1cupbell pepper, diced (fresh or frozen- I used frozen)
1 15-ozcan tomato sauce
1tspdried basil
2tspmild italian sausage seasoning(can sub italian seasoning)
1/2tspsalt(or to taste)
Instructions
Preheat oven to 375° F.
FOR POTATOES: Chop potatoes into one inch pieces. You can peel them, but I skipped it. Place chopped potatoes in a large pot of water. Bring to a boil and cook until potatoes are tender. (About 15 - 20 minutes)
Drain water from pot. Mash the potatoes. Add ghee, broth, and salt + pepper. Continue to mash until no lumps remain. Cover potatoes and set aside.
FOR MEAT LAYER: In a large 12-inch cast iron or other oven-safe skillet, over medium-high heat, add 1 tbsp oil, then add ground turkey, onion, and peppers (if they're raw). Cook and crumble meat until browned.
Stir in tomato sauce, salt, basil, italian sausage seasoning and peppers (if using frozen).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to medium-low.
Remove meat from heat. Spread mashed potatoes evenly over the top.
If serving immediately: bake for 30 minutes. Add pepperoni when 15 minutes remain.
If making ahead for later: Place pan in refrigerator. When ready to cook, preheat oven to 375° F. Bake for ~45 minutes. Add pepperoni when 15 minutes remain.
Notes
For picky eaters- remove 1-2 servings of mashed potatoes before topping the dish to serve plain on the side. I also removed some plain turkey for my son before adding the sauce and seasonings.This recipe yields about 8 servings.
